ALGO is the token of Algorand, a self-sustaining, decentralized, blockchain-based network that supports a wide range of applications. It also self-proclaimed as the “FutureFi” or Future of Finance. The technology is intentionally designed to enable the simple creation of next generation financial products and disrupt economic models across industries where the exchange of value can be made more efficient.
Read more on ALGO →Telos is a high-performance Layer-1 blockchain that prioritizes scalability, security, and real-world usability. It features an EVM-compatible infrastructure, allowing developers to deploy Ethereum-based DApps with faster transaction speeds and lower costs. TLOS is the native utility token used for gas fees, staking, and governance.
